Commit graph

22 commits

Author SHA1 Message Date
Birte Kristina Friesel
45dc2e4e2a
Switch to new carriage formation API 2024-08-08 21:13:39 +02:00
Birte Kristina Friesel
c382a121a5
lock DBWagenreihung to 0.12 2024-04-28 13:46:51 +02:00
Birte Kristina Friesel
fe0dbf7588
wagon order: indicate closed wagons 2024-03-29 13:54:19 +01:00
Birte Kristina Friesel
d47195a0cf
Switch to Travel::Status::DE::HAFAS 5.x 2023-12-27 10:59:35 +01:00
Birte Kristina Friesel
5a571f6352
Pin Travel::Status::DE::HAFAS to latest release prior to 5.00 2023-12-11 06:47:01 +01:00
Birte Kristina Friesel
52c0da3f46
Traewelling: replace legacy password login with OAuth2
This is a breaking change insofar as that traewelling support is no longer
provided automatically, but must be enabled by providing a traewelling.de
application ID and secret in travelynx.conf. However, as traewelling.de
password login is deprecated and wil soon be disabled, travelynx would break
either way. So we might or might not see travelynx 2.0.0 in the next days.

Automatic token refresh is still todo, but that was the case for password
login as well.

Closes #64
2023-08-07 21:17:10 +02:00
Derf Null
07fe4ecd1f
cpanfile: add Text:Markdown 2023-06-04 14:33:22 +02:00
Daniel Friesel
d75ae5eb45
travelynx no longer requires XML::LibXML 2022-11-09 18:15:18 +01:00
Daniel Friesel
087d3871e1
Use Travel::Status::DE::HAFAS instead of traininfo.exe for journey details 2022-11-05 19:19:52 +01:00
Daniel Friesel
2695442199
cpanfile: Do not hardcode IRIS version 2021-10-30 09:43:51 +02:00
Daniel Friesel
3dc5575d5a
Switch from Geo::Distance (deprecated) to GIS::Distance 2021-10-23 22:20:41 +02:00
Daniel Friesel
70c3a5d9c8
Geo::Distance::XS has been removed from CPAN; update cpanfile.snapshot 2021-10-09 22:41:44 +02:00
Daniel Friesel
32b2c941df
Bump T-S-DE-IRIS dependency to 1.60 2021-09-12 11:35:36 +02:00
Daniel Friesel
84afb1bc2c departures: show annotation if no realtime data is available 2021-07-18 20:43:55 +02:00
Daniel Friesel
f5fd6d42e1 Add CSV Export 2020-04-19 18:26:20 +02:00
Daniel Friesel
e7a6cfa931 Correctly encode non-ASCII e-mail content. Fixes spamfilter issues.
New dependency: MIME::Entity
2020-03-14 14:56:02 +01:00
Daniel Friesel
0822cfc993 add auto-generated passenger rights forms 2019-09-12 18:07:21 +02:00
Daniel Friesel
7c7b5e9f95
Do not show station duplicates in geolocation list 2019-07-20 15:42:49 +02:00
Daniel Friesel
6b9bf8e486 Add 'Travel::Status::DE::DBWagenreihung' dependency 2019-06-24 17:24:17 +02:00
Daniel Friesel
c5ea2c5147 Add explicit libxml dependency to cpanfile 2019-05-31 23:58:30 +02:00
Daniel Friesel
812be4f0cb Finish transition from DBI to Mojo::Pg 2019-04-22 13:42:41 +02:00
Daniel Friesel
cd942d0001 Add cpanfile for dependency management with Carton 2019-04-21 18:15:43 +02:00